YesToTheOffer and LockedIn AI both sit in the real-time interview copilot category. LockedIn AI publicly describes an interview and meeting copilot with live answers, coaching, coding support, resume/job setup, transcription, and post-interview feedback. The better choice depends less on a feature checklist and more on your actual interview loop: coding only, mixed software engineering, PM, consulting, behavioral rounds, or system design.

LockedIn AI emphasizes a copilot and coach model, real-time answers, coding help, resume and job-description setup, transcription, and post-interview analysis. YesToTheOffer focuses on a desktop interview copilot that ties live transcription, screenshots, coding, resume grounding, private knowledge, and review into one workflow.
